Resolving Siemens PLC Communication Errors (6ES7 Series)
When facing communication problems with your Siemens 6ES7 series PLCs, a methodical problem-solving approach is essential. Begin by confirming the physical connections between the PLC and its components. Check for loose or damaged cables, ensuring proper termination. Examine the PLC's interface settings to ensure they are aligned with the connected devices. If physical connections and settings appear sound, delve into the PLC's diagnostics capabilities for specific error codes. Consult the corresponding documentation to interpret these codes and isolate the root cause of the communication failure.

Boosting Performance with Siemens 6ES7 Controllers
Siemens 6ES7 controllers are renowned for their robustness and flexibility, empowering industrial automation applications across diverse sectors. To harness their full potential and achieve optimal performance, meticulous configuration and fine-tuning are essential. Integrating proven strategies can significantly enhance the efficiency, reliability, and overall effectiveness of your automation system.
A fundamental aspect of performance optimization involves selecting the appropriate program architecture. Employing a modular design with well-defined tasks promotes code readability, maintainability, and fault isolation.
- Additionally, adjusting the controller's communication parameters can eliminate network latency and ensure seamless data exchange between devices.
- Periodically monitoring system performance metrics, such as cycle times and error rates, provides valuable insights into potential areas for improvement.
Therefore, a commitment to continuous performance evaluation and adjustment is crucial for maximizing the value of Siemens 6ES7 controllers in your industrial automation environment.
